Main Office
5713 49th St, Flushing, NY 11378-0038
(718) 386-7700
We Are Here
Display Designers & Producers Mfrs in Flushing, New York
Display Fixtures & Materials (Wholesale) in NY 11378
Display Fixtures & Materials (Wholesale) in Flushing, New York